4.

Genome-epigenome interactions associated with Myalgic Encephalomyelitis/Chronic Fatigue Syndrome

(Submitter supplied) Myalgic Encephalomyelitis/Chronic Fatigue Syndrome (ME/CFS) is a complex disease of unknown etiology. Multiple studies point to disruptions in immune functioning in ME/CFS patients as well as specific genetic polymorphisms and alterations of the DNA methylome in lymphocytes. However, potential interactions between DNA methylation and genetic background in relation to ME/CFS have not been examined. In this study we explored this association by characterizing the epigenetic (~480 thousand CpG loci) and genetic (~4.3 million SNPs) variation between cohorts of ME/CFS patients and healthy controls. more...

9.

Sex-Dependent Transcriptional Changes in response to stress in patients with Myalgic Encephalomyelitis/Chronic Fatigue Syndrome

(Submitter supplied) Myalgic encephalomyelitis/chronic fatigue syndrome (ME/CFS) is a complex, multi-symptom illness characterized by debilitating fatigue and post-exertional malaise (PEM). Numerous studies have reported sex differences at the epidemiological, cellular, and molecular levels between male and female ME/CFS patients. To gain further insight into these sex-dependent changes, we evaluated differential gene expression by RNA-sequencing in 35 ME/CFS patients (24 female, 11 male) and 34 matched healthy control participants (21 female and 13 male) during and after an exercise challenge intended to provoke PEM. more...

20.

Single-cell transcriptomics of the immune system in ME/CFS at baseline and following symptom provocation

(Submitter supplied) ME/CFS is a serious and poorly understood disease. To understand immune dysregulation in ME/CFS, we used single-cell RNA-seq (scRNA-seq) to examine immune cells in cohorts of patients and controls. Post-exertional malaise (PEM), an exacerbation of symptoms following exercise, is a characteristic symptom of ME/CFS. Thus, to detect changes coincident with PEM, we also performed scRNA-seq on the same cohorts following exercise. more...
